What is the key factor in the Courts decision to hear a case?

Respuesta :

yyellowcreek yyellowcreek
  • 04-06-2020

Answer:

In order for the case to be heard, four justices must agree to hear the case. This is known as the Rule of Four. If four justices vote to hear the case, then it is placed onto the court's docket and the parties and their attorney's are notified that the Supreme Court agrees to hear the case.
